Omaha Westside entered their matchup against Bellevue East on Wednesday without any home losses, but there's a first time for everything. The Omaha Westside Warriors lost 13-3 to the Bellevue East Chieftains. The Warriors were given a dose of their own medicine in this game as the Chieftains apparently hadn't forgotten their loss the last time these teams played back in September of 2023.
Omaha Westside now has a losing record at 3-4-1. As for Bellevue East, the win (which was their third in a row) raised their record to 6-2.
Both squads are looking forward to the support of their home crowds in their upcoming games. Omaha Westside will square off against Silo at 3:00 p.m. on Thursday. As for Bellevue East, they will face off against Columbus at 6:30 p.m. on Thursday. Bellevue East is strutting in with some hitting muscle as they've averaged 7.2 runs per game this season.
